Step-by-step troubleshooting
Check Thermostat Settings
Do: Verify the thermostat is set to 'Heat' and the temperature is higher than the current room temperature.
Observe: Thermostat remains in 'Cool' or 'Auto' mode.
Means: Thermostat misconfiguration.
Next: Switch to 'Heat' mode and wait 10 minutes to see if heating activates.
Inspect Air Filter
Do: Remove and examine the air filter for dirt or blockage.
Observe: Filter is clogged with dust or debris.
Means: Restricted airflow due to dirty filter.
Next: Replace the filter and test the heating function again.
Check for Error Codes
Do: Look at the AC unit's control panel for any blinking lights or error codes.
Observe: Error codes are displayed on the unit.
Means: Internal system malfunction.
Next: Refer to the unit's manual to interpret the codes and address the issue.
Test Blower Motor
Do: Listen for the blower motor to engage when the heating function is activated.
Observe: Blower motor does not start or makes unusual noises.
Means: Blower motor failure or electrical issue.
Next: Use a multimeter to test the motor's electrical connections and continuity.
Verify Heat Source Activation
Do: Check if the heating element or heat pump is receiving power and activating.
Observe: No power to the heating component or it fails to activate.
Means: Faulty heating element or heat pump.
Next: Consult a licensed HVAC technician for further diagnosis and repair.
Inspect Emergency Heat Setting
Do: If using a heat pump, check the emergency heat setting on the thermostat.
Observe: Emergency heat is not engaged or is malfunctioning.
Means: Thermostat or heat pump issue.
Next: Toggle the emergency heat setting and monitor the system's response.
Common causes table
| Cause | Why | Likelihood | Difficulty | Part often needed |
|---|---|---|---|---|
| Thermostat set to 'Cool' mode | System defaults to cooling function when not in heating mode. | High | Low | None |
| Dirty air filter | Restricted airflow prevents proper heating distribution. | High | Low | Air filter |
| Blower motor failure | Motor not circulating heated air through the system. | Medium | High | Blower motor |
| Faulty heating element | Electric resistance heating component is damaged or burned out. | Medium | High | Heating element |
| Heat pump malfunction | Heat pump not switching to heating mode or reversing valve failure. | Medium | High | Heat pump repair |
| Thermostat wiring issue | Loose or disconnected wires prevent proper signal transmission. | Low | Medium | Thermostat |
| Low refrigerant level | Heat pump requires proper refrigerant charge to transfer heat effectively. | Low | High | Professional refrigerant recharge |
| Defective circuit board | Control board not sending power to heating components. | Low | High | Control board |
Parts matching
When replacing parts, ensure compatibility with your AC unit's model and specifications.
- Air filter: match filter size (inches) and MERV rating
- Thermostat: verify compatibility with your HVAC system type
- Blower motor: match motor horsepower and RPM
- Heating element: ensure correct wattage and voltage
- Control board: match unit model number and specifications
Consult your unit's manual for specific part requirements and installation instructions.

FAQ
Can a dirty air filter cause heating issues?
Yes, a clogged air filter restricts airflow, reducing the system's heating efficiency and potentially causing overheating.
Why is my AC not heating even when the thermostat is set to 'Heat'?
The thermostat may be malfunctioning, or the system might be in cooling mode. Check the thermostat settings and wiring connections.
How do I know if my heating element is faulty?
If the system runs but doesn't produce heat, and the blower motor works, the heating element may be burned out. Test with a multimeter for continuity.
Is it normal for the heat pump to make noise during heating?
Some noise is normal, but loud or unusual sounds may indicate a mechanical issue requiring professional inspection.
Can I use my AC for heating in very cold weather?
Heat pumps are less efficient in extreme cold. Consider using a supplemental heating source or switching to emergency heat if available.
